Sri Lankan Beef Curry

User Reviews

5.0

42 reviews
Excellent
  • Prep Time

    20 mins

  • Cook Time

    20 mins

  • Additional Time

    1 hr

  • Total Time

    2 hrs 5 mins

  • Servings

    5 servings

  • Calories

    472 kcal

  • Cuisine

    Sri Lankan

Sri Lankan Beef Curry

An authentic and flavorful Sri Lankan beef curry recipe, that is adaptable and versatile! Made from scratch with a homemade curry powder. Naturally gluten free and keto-friendly. Great for meal prep too.EASY - This recipe is easy, but there is a lengthy cook time. Please read the post for tips on how to make a quick version of this curry that cuts down on time. But keep in mind it may impact the depth of flavor.Some variations in the ingredients are OK. Weight measurements do not have to be precise.

I Made This!

Be the first!

Save this

Be the first!

Ingredients

Servings

Beef marinade

  • 1 kg beef chuck (2.2 lbs) cut into ¾ - 1 inch pieces
  • ½ tbsp Sri Lankan Curry Powder
  • 1 tsp sea salt

For the curry

  • 1 - 2 tbsp coconut oil or any flavorless oil such as vegetable oil
  • ½ medium onion sliced (or 1 small onion)
  • 4 garlic cloves or 5 - 6 small garlic cloves, finely chopped
  • 1 ½ tbsp ginger finely chopped
  • 8 - 10 curry leaves fresh or dried (or use 2 bay leaves)
  • 2 fresh green chilis or jalapenos
  • 1 ½ tbsp Sri Lankan Curry Powder
  • 1 tsp ground black pepper use less for a milder curry
  • 1 tsp cayenne pepper use less for a milder curry
  • 1 tsp ground ceylon cinnamon
  • salt to taste
  • ½ cup water
  • ½ cup coconut milk
Add to Shopping List

Instructions

  1. Cut the beef into bite-sized pieces, and place it in a bowl. Add the salt and curry powder for the marinade, and mix. Let the beef marinate for at least one hour if you can, OR in the fridge overnight or up to 24 hours.
  2. Slice the onions. Finely chop the ginger and garlic. Slice the green chili either lengthwise or across. Remove the seeds and white pith if you prefer, to lessen the heat.
  3. Heat a large pot over medium high heat. Add the oil, and once heated, add the onion and saute for a few minutes until the onions start to soften.
  4. Add the garlic, ginger, curry leaves, and green chilis. Saute until the onions are translucent.
  5. Add the curry powder and saute for a few seconds until you can smell the spices.
  6. Add the rest of the spices, along with the marinated beef. Stir well to coat the beef with the spices.
  7. Saute the beef for about 15 - 20 minutes. Some caramelization on the meat pieces is ideal, but not necessary.
  8. Add the water and let it come to a boil. Add the coconut milk at this point, if you'd like the coconut milk to split in the curry. This enhances the flavor of the curry. Otherwise, leave out the coconut milk until towards the end of the cook time. This will yield a creamy curry sauce.
  9. Lower the heat to a simmer. Let the curry simmer (uncovered), for about 30 minutes. Stir regularly.
  10. Add a little more water, as needed, if the water is evaporating. You can also place the lid on the pot half way through the cooking time.
  11. When the beef is very tender (about 30 - 40 minutes of simmering), the curry is ready. Taste and season to your preference.
  12. If you didn’t add the coconut milk at the beginning, then add it towards the end of the cook time. Stir the coconut milk through the curry, and allow the curry to come back to a simmer.
  13. The curry is now ready. Let the curry preferably rest for about 30 minutes to let the flavors “mingle”. But it can also be served right away at this point too.

Make ahead tips / storing leftovers

  1. Store the curry in portions. Store enough for 1 meal, in separate containers. Curries can be stored in the fridge for up to 3 days, but avoid reheating and refrigerating multiple times.
  2. The curry will keep in the freezer for at least up to 2 months. Store in separate containers, so that you can thaw and reheat only what you need for one meal at a time.

Notes

  • You can skip the step where you marinate the beef. 
  • Also, you can cut the beef into thinner slices so that it becomes tender sooner and cooks faster. OR use a fat marbled beef cut (sirloin) to make the curry, which will also become tender faster.
  • Leftovers can be used for another meal, OR be used to make these curried beef buns, curried grilled cheese or kotthu roti (substitute the chicken with your leftover beef).

Nutrition Information

Show Details
Calories 472kcal (24%) Carbohydrates 5g (2%) Protein 40g (80%) Fat 34g (52%) Saturated Fat 19g (95%) Trans Fat 1g Cholesterol 138mg (46%) Sodium 634mg (26%) Potassium 793mg (23%) Fiber 1g (4%) Sugar 1g (2%) Vitamin A 277IU (6%) Vitamin C 34mg (38%) Calcium 65mg (7%) Iron 6mg (33%)

Nutrition Facts

Serving: 5servings

Amount Per Serving

Calories 472 kcal

% Daily Value*

Calories 472kcal 24%
Carbohydrates 5g 2%
Protein 40g 80%
Fat 34g 52%
Saturated Fat 19g 95%
Trans Fat 1g 50%
Cholesterol 138mg 46%
Sodium 634mg 26%
Potassium 793mg 17%
Fiber 1g 4%
Sugar 1g 2%
Vitamin A 277IU 6%
Vitamin C 34mg 38%
Calcium 65mg 7%
Iron 6mg 33%

* Percent Daily Values are based on a 2,000 calorie diet.

Genuine Reviews

User Reviews

Overall Rating

5.0

42 reviews
Excellent

Write a Review

Drag & drop files here or click to upload
Other Recipes

You'll Also Love

Sri Lankan Jackfruit Curry (Polos Curry)

Sri Lankan
5.0 (36 reviews)

Best Chicken Curry (Sri Lankan Chicken Curry)

Asian, Indian, Sri Lankan
5.0 (750 reviews)

Easy Red Lentil Curry (Sri Lankan Dhal Curry)

Indian, Sri Lankan
5.0 (9 reviews)

Sri Lankan Mango Curry

Sri Lankan
5.0 (36 reviews)

Sri Lankan Creamy Cashew Curry (Vegan)

Sri Lankan
4.8 (66 reviews)

Sri Lankan Oyster Mushroom Curry

Sri Lankan
5.0 (12 reviews)

Easy Sri Lankan Carrot Curry

Sri Lankan
5.0 (9 reviews)

Sri Lankan Fish Curry Recipe

Sri Lankan
5.0 (33 reviews)

Sri Lankan Meatball Curry

Indian, Sri Lankan
5.0 (12 reviews)

Sri Lankan Pumpkin Curry

Sri Lankan
5.0 (36 reviews)

Sri Lankan Crab Curry

Sri Lankan
5.0 (27 reviews)

Sri Lankan Beetroot Curry

Sri Lankan
5.0 (117 reviews)

Sri Lankan Green Bean Stir Fry

Sri Lankan
5.0 (15 reviews)

Authentic Mutton Curry Recipe

Indian, Sri Lankan
5.0 (36 reviews)